Robbins Brothers Goes Chapter 11
Robbins Brothers, a 16-store California-based chain with locations in San Diego, Houston, Dallas, and Chicago, has filed a Chapter 11 petition in U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the District of Delaware. » » »
LUXURY & PREMIERE to be a Three-Day Event
LUXURY & PREMIERE, the 10-year old invitation-only event for the finest jewelry retailers and manufacturers, will be held for three days rather than the previously announced four days, JCK Events said in a statement Wednesday. The new dates are May 27 - 29. » » »

JA Appoints Robert Headley as its First COO
Jewelers of America has named Robert Headley as its first chief operating officer, effective Feb. 23. The position has been established as part of the association’s three-year strategic plan, which was adopted by its board of directors in 2008. » » »
NY State Jewelers to Celebrate 100 Years
The New York State Jewelers Association, founded in 1909 to foster, promote, and protect the welfare of jewelers in the state, will host its Centennial Anniversary celebration with a gala dinner on Saturday, July 25, at the Mandarin Oriental Hotel. » » »
PGI Recognizes Top Platinum Salespersons
Platinum Guild International has named the winners of the 2008 “Platinum Sellers Contest,” a national contest recognizing sales associates within PGI’s 4P program, who sold the most number of platinum units in their store from Oct. 1 to Dec. 21, 2008. » » »

ICSC: Same Store Sales Down 0.1% for Chains
U.S. chain store sales for February 2009 were off 0.1 percent on a year-over-year same-store basis, according to the International Council of Shopping Centers, Inc. The organization said the result is an improvement over previous monthly performances. » » »
Transparency is Goal of New Thai Trade Rules
The Thai Department of Export Promotion has collaborated with the kingdom’s excise department, revenue department, and the private sector to launch the "Thai Gems and Jewelry Trading Route." The campaign primarily aims to create better understanding among local and foreign operators of regulations governing the conduct of gems trade. » » »
